Transaction ec384f3bb0300661604288b1febfb808b0c9e728bdce51195a7637726b058d0e
1 Input
1 Output
-
ec384f3bb0300661604288b1febfb808b0c9e728bdce51195a7637726b058d0e:0
- value
- 241286870
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b1596a6f1f9ac4a516248d1298e36f1ca582ac2c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HAjifr7w6RxsQKocACG5cKWDmEx59jLVW